The first of its kind in kids' yogurt selection, Super Danimals contains a specific strain of probiotics called Lactobacillus casei DN-144 001, as well as vitamins C and D. "The benefits of probiotics are strain-specific, so it’s important to choose the right probiotic strain for the right benefit," Leigh tells Romper. When consumed regularly as part of a balanced diet and a healthy lifestyle, Leigh says that the billions of live and active probiotics work within a child's digestive tract where about 70% of their immune system is located.

Leigh says that in addition to the probiotics — which generally help relieve constipation, acid reflux, diarrhea symptoms, and gas, according to the Cleveland Clinic — there's also a lot of vitamins C and D in the snack.
